Looks like the WhiteKnightTwo won’t be all play after all, as the British government wants to use Virgin Galactic‘s spacecraft to send some state satellites into low orbit.

https://gizmodo.com/first-virgin-galactic-white-knight-ii-photos-5029950

According to Flight Global, The Government wants to develop a rocket, dubbed “LauncherOne,” to sit on the back of WhiteKnightTwo and when the craft reaches the proper altitude, lauch off on its own to begin orbit. The microsatellites would be under 200kg in weight, though it’s unclear exactly what the satellites will do.
